πŸ“‹ Key Responsibilities

βœ… Lead the development and execution of a refreshed marketing and business strategy aligned with global direction and regional market dynamics

βœ… Develop and execute regional marketing plans aligned with the global vision for Specimen Management

βœ… Identify regional growth drivers through market research, voice of customer (VOC) insights, business analytics, and market sizing

βœ… Own and partner with countries to deliver key business metrics including revenue, margin, pricing, and other metrics

βœ… Develop, review, and support regional tactical plans to anticipate and address changes in market trends, customer needs, and external environments

βœ… Lead portfolio performance reporting, including monthly updates, quarterly projections, and ASR

βœ… Inject creativity and innovation to re-energize a well-established portfolio and reconnect with evolving customer needs

βœ… Identify and drive new growth opportunities, including new segments, product initiatives (NPIs), and OEM partnerships

βœ… Pilot innovative digital platforms and omnichannel campaigns in the region

βœ… Ensure optimal product mix, portfolio GP% adherence, supply chain alignment, and end-of-life (EOL) planning

βœ… Act as the Voice of Region, maintaining strong product and country knowledge and feedback loops

βœ… Build strong evidence and partnerships with key opinion leaders (KOLs) to reinforce brand credibility and differentiation

βœ… Strengthen BD’s value proposition through a solution-based, outcome-driven narrative

βœ… Build and maintain strategic relationships with instrument companies and ecosystem partners to enhance end-to-end solutions and market access

βœ… Actively expand BD’s external network through collaborations with clinical societies, lab associations, and healthcare influencers

βœ… Own business performance: revenue, %SGP, and marketing budget accountability

βœ… Bring a strong understanding of key markets in Greater Asia, ensuring strategies are locally relevant and regionally scalable

βœ… Collaborate cross-functionally with Supply Chain, Finance, HEOR, regional/country teams, and global stakeholders

βœ… Actively contribute as a member of the SM Leadership Team and Global SM Marketing Leadership Team

βœ… Lead and develop a team of 3 direct reports, fostering high performance, creativity, and executional excellence, while working closely with Country Marketing teams and partnering with Global Marketing Team

βœ… Promote a culture of experimentation, innovation, and resilienceβ€”comfortable with learning through iteration

βœ… Leadership ability to influence without authority, develop and empower associates to achieve objectives with a team approach including careful delegation of tasks while maintaining responsibility for the final result

Company Description:

  • BD is a global medical technology company that manufactures and sells medical equipment, medical systems, and reagents
  • The company focuses on improving drug treatment, improving the quality and speed of diagnosis of infectious diseases, and promoting the research and discovery of new drugs and vaccines
  • BD has strong research and development capabilities to fight many of the world's most intractable diseases
